The cartographic institute Schubert & Franzke Gesellschaft mbH , better known under the name Schubert & Franzke, with headquarters in St. Pölten , is a cartographic publisher in Austria .

history

The company Schubert & Franzke Gesellschaft mbH was founded in 1985 and focused on the creation of city and local maps for cities and communities. In 1993, the company completely converted its cartography to a digital platform. In 1999 Schubert & Franzke launched the online map map2web.

Business areas

The three current priorities of the Schubert & Franzke company are the production of city and local maps, the provision of online maps and map-based mobile apps .
